SubCom to manufacture and install MANTA subsea system

Developing Telecoms

The three partners behind MANTA, a new subsea cable system connecting Mexico and the USA with Central and Latin America, have announced that SubCom, which engineers, manufactures, and installs subsea fibre optic data cables, has been awarded a contract for the design, manufacture and installation of the MANTA system.

Nokia and Carrix Transform US Ports with 5G DAC Network

VoIP Review

Nokia has partnered with Carrix, a leading US port and rail yard operator, to deploy its Digital Automation Cloud (DAC) private 4G and 5G networks across multiple US container terminals. Beyond connectivity, DAC’s enhancement of security and easy maintenance simplifies operations for Carrix.
